Editorial overview Touché

A Good and Useful Hurt by Aric Davis, published by Amazon Publishing on February 21, 2012, is a 293-page work of fiction that intertwines elements of horror, mystery, and psychological thriller. The narrative follows Mike, a tattoo artist, and Deb, a piercing artist he hires, as they navigate unexpected romance amidst their chaotic careers and personal lives. The story takes a dark turn when Mike begins tattooing the ashes of deceased loved ones into his customers’ tattoos, leading to unforeseen consequences that intertwine with a serial killer’s actions.

Readers will find a gripping exploration of love, revenge, and the boundaries between life and death. As Mike and Deb confront the chaos surrounding them, they are propelled into a quest that challenges their understanding of pain and redemption. The book delves into themes of loss and the haunting realities of their profession, offering a unique perspective on the intertwining of art and mortality. With its blend of suspense and psychological depth, A Good and Useful Hurt presents a narrative that resonates with those drawn to complex emotional landscapes.


Official synopsis Publisher

Mike is a tattoo artist running his own shop, and Deb is the piercing artist he hires to round out his studio’s motley crew of four. The last either expects is romance, but that’s what they get as they follow their off-kilter careers and love lives into complete and total disaster.

When Mike follows a growing trend and tattoos the ashes of deceased loved ones into several customers’ tattoos, he has no idea that it will one day provide the solution — and solace — he will sorely need. And when the life of a serial killer tragically collides with the lives in the tattoo shop, Mike and Deb will stop at nothing in their quest for revenge, even if it means stepping outside the known boundaries of life and death. Ink that is full of crematory ashes, a sociopathic killer, and pain in its rawest form…this is going to hurt.

When the hope of redemption runs headlong into the dark side of life’s chaos, we are left with one of the most haunting thrillers in recent memory. A Good and Useful Hurt delivers the bittersweet essence of life with the sting of a needle in skin.
